void solve (int CaseNo)
{
    int n, d; cin >> n >> d;
    vector<int> h(n);
    for (int i = 0; i < n; i++) cin >> h[i];

    int mx = (1 << n);
    vector<vector<int>> dp(mx, vector<int> (n)); /// dp[mask][top block or last block]

    // base case
    for (int i = 0; i < n; i++)
    {
        dp[1 << i][i] = 1;
    }

    // dbg (dp);

    for (int mask = 0; mask < mx; mask++)
    {
        for (int j = 0; j < n; j++)
        {
            if ((mask & (1 << j)) == 0) continue;
            for (int k = 0; k < n; k++)
            {
                if ((mask & (1 << k)) == 0 && h[k] <= (h[j] + d))
                {
                    int newMask = mask | (1 << k);
                    dp[newMask][k] += dp[mask][j];
                    dp[newMask][k] %= MOD;
                }       
            }
        }
    }

    int ans = 0;
    for (int i= 0; i < n; i++)
    {
        ans += dp[mx-1][i];
        ans %= MOD;
    }

    cout << ans << endl;
}
